#4e552b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#4e552b is composed of 30.6% red, 33.3% green and 16.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 8.2% cyan, 0% magenta, 49.4% yellow and 66.7% black. It has a hue angle of 70 degrees, a saturation of 32.8% and a lightness of 25.1%. #4e552b color hex could be obtained by blending #9caa56 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#666633.

Shades and Tints of #4e552b

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#060703 is the darkest color, while #fbfcf9 is the lightest one.

Tones of #4e552b

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#41413f is the less saturated color, while #687c04 is the most saturated one.
